Abstract
AbstractThe purpose of the study was to determine the organizational structure of effective middle level schools measured by the achievement gain of students on standardized achievement tests. The study utilized achievement scores obtained from middle level schools in both reading and mathematics as well as survey research to determine teacher, department chair/team leader, principal and superintendent perception of the organizational structure of participating middle level school in Missouri.
